Job Requirements

  • Legal documentation establishing identity and eligibility for employment
  • Ability to work full time with variable hours exceeding 40 hours per week
  • Willingness to work early mornings, evenings, weekends, and holidays
  • Commitment to uphold Starbucks’ values and culture

Job Qualifications

  • Minimum high school diploma or GED
  • 3 years of retail or customer service management experience or 4+ years of US military service
  • Strong leadership and interpersonal skills
  • Entrepreneurial mindset with sales-focused experience
  • Proven problem-solving abilities
  • Ability to work flexible hours including early mornings, evenings, weekends, and holidays

Job Duties

  • Lead and mentor a team to deliver exceptional customer service
  • Oversee daily store operations to ensure quality and efficiency
  • Foster a positive and inclusive workplace culture
  • Manage inventory and financial performance
  • Implement sales strategies and drive business growth
  • Coach partners with professional maturity and support their development
  • Ensure compliance with health and safety standards
